
Wyoming Hospital Awards $9K in Healthcare Scholarships
Three Wyoming high school seniors pursuing healthcare careers will receive $3,000 scholarships from Memorial Hospital of Sweetwater County. Applications are due March 27 for students ready to make a difference in medicine.
Memorial Hospital of Sweetwater County is investing $9,000 in the next generation of healthcare workers, offering three scholarships to local high school seniors with big medical dreams.
The Wyoming hospital's medical staff is putting their money where their mission is. They're offering two $3,000 scholarships to graduating seniors, one from each of Sweetwater County's two school districts. The medical staff contributes $1,500 per scholarship, and the hospital matches every dollar.
A third $3,000 scholarship comes from the hospital's marketing department on behalf of all employees. This one goes specifically to a Rock Springs High School Health Academy student who's already committed to the healthcare path.
The deadline is March 27, giving students just weeks to apply for these opportunities that could ease the financial burden of pursuing medical careers.
